DWP ‘broken’ benefit cap could see 35,000 more families miss out on extra money next April

New analysis from Child Poverty Action Group (CPAG) shows that around 35,000 more families across the UK could have their benefits capped next April, leaving them with a growing gulf between their income and rising costs in living. In Scotland 4,000 households are affected by the arbitrary limit to benefit entitlements.

DWP confirms no plans to extend £650 cost of living support to people claiming PIP or Carer’s Allowance

The Department for Work and Pensions (DWP) has dismissed a call from Conservative MP, Virginia Crosbie, to assess the “potential merits of extending the £650 support for the rise in energy” to include people on Personal Independence Payment (PIP) and Carer's Allowance.

DWP rejects call to give £650 cost of living payment to people on contribution-based ESA

The Department for Work and Pensions (DWP) has rejected a call from Labour MP, Charlotte Nichols, to widen the eligibility scope for the one-off £650 Cost of Living Payment to include people on contribution-based Employment Support Allowance and other non-means tested benefits.

More than 500,000 people in privately rented properties could miss out on £400 energy bill support

Citizens Advice is warning that more than half a million people across the UK could miss out on the UK Government's £400 support for energy customers from October because they are in a privately rented property.

DWP confirms 770,000 people of State Pension age could be due up to £278 extra each week

The Department for Work and Pensions (DWP) has confirmed that across the UK, there are an estimated 770,000 people of State Pension age who qualify for a ‘gateway’ benefit which can provide up to £278 extra each week plus access to other discounts on housing, Council Tax and TV licences.
